How do I connect boxes in Salesforce?

To enable Box integrations for the Salesforce mobile application:

  1. From the Salesforce menu, in the top right corner, click Setup.
  2. Navigate to App Setup > Customize, and click the object you want to add the Box Embed interface. Supported objects include: Accounts. Cases. Opportunities. Contacts. Leads.

How do I uninstall a Salesforce box?

From Setup -> Build -> Installed Packages, click Uninstall on Box for Salesforce.

What is a box service account?

A Service Account provides developers with a programmatic authentication mechanism for server-side integrations with Box. In other words, an application can authenticate to Box as the service, which is represented by a Service Account user.

Where can I get box for Salesforce integration?

The Box for Salesforce integration is available at no extra charge for joint Box Enterprise/Salesforce customers. To get the integration, contact your Box Customer Success Manager or visit the Box for Salesforce integration page on the Salesforce App Exchange.
